Red Hat Linux 8.0 hangs as an LDAP client when LDAP server goes down
Hey, everyone!
I'm having this tough problem around. We've set up successfully a
network with Directory administrator, OpenLDAP, and a few servers posing
as LDAP clients, for centralized authentication management. This all
goes well, if we don't notice that OpenLDAP is much slower than the
local password database.
Now, when the LDAP server goes down, all the Red Hat 8.0 servers using
it as authentication source hang. Completely hang. No log-ins
possible, open root sessions malfunction (ps, ls, all commands hang). I
do know this is supposed to happen with the current state of the art in
open source LDAP tools. I suppose I can live with this, temporarily,
but it really shouldn't happen (software should be smart, fail smartly
and let the rest of the system go on).
What strikes me as very odd is that when the LDAP server comes back up,
the clients do NOT return to a working state. They all have to be
power-cycled (a vulcan nerve pinch doesn't affect them). This is what
it's not acceptable. We could deal with five minutes downtime in all
our servers when the LDAP server has to go down for maintenance, but we
simply can't deal with powercycling all Linux servers when the LDAP
server goes down, or powering them down in a certain order.
Two questions:
1) Do any of you guys know of people enhancing NSS, PAM and others to
make LDAP authentication run smoothly when the LDAP server fails
(perhaps immediately returning instead of hanging forever and ever). I
know I could set up a backup server, and at some point we will do. But
the server should just chug along when the LDAP server fails (perhaps
losing functionality for LDAP-stored users, but no more).
2) Why do all LDAP clients hang when the server goes down, and remain
hung even after it has come up?
Thanks in advance.
Manuel Amador
Universidad Tecnica Federico Santa Maria
Campus Guayaquil
_______________________________________________
LinuxManagers mailing list - http://www.linuxmanagers.org
submissions: LinuxManagers@linuxmanagers.org
subscribe/unsubscribe: http://www.linuxmanagers.org/mailman/listinfo/linuxmanagers
[Home]
[Kernel List]
[Linux SCSI]
[Video 4 Linux]
[Linux Admin]
[Yosemite News]
[Motherboards]